Finesse and One Hill Solutions Release SmartLab' Platform for Lab-Scale Bioprocess Optimization

SANTA CLARA, California, June 21, 2016 /PRNewswire/ --FinesseSolutions, Inc., a manufacturer of measurement and control solutions for life sciences process applications, in partnership with One Hill Solutions, an innovative software developer in Massachusetts, announced the launch of the SmartLab platform for lab-scale bioprocess optimization. SmartLab is the first end-to-end datamanagement system to integrate leading third-party design-of-experiment (DoE) software, multivariable data analysis (MVDA), recipe management, data visualization and seamless analyzer connectivity.

SmartLab is based on the RECONN software engine developed by One Hill Solutions. It also includes the TruBio®, TruPur' and TruChrom' bioreactor control software and SmartSystems developed by Finesse. SmartLab will allow both life sciences research and process development groups a novel and cost-effective data archiving solution, centralized data/recipe mining for DoE or statistical analysis and remote access to process reports, plots and live trend visualization against a "golden batch." The SmartLab software will also have the capability to notify users by email or text when batch reports are ready for viewing, when online values are out of range, or when network connections are down.

"RECONN, as its name implies, was originally developed to obtain information about the activities of intelligent bioprocessing systems and to secure data of a particular batch," said Rami Mitri, president of One Hill Solutions. "We recognized the need for efficient execution of instant data visualization and analysis of experiments in laboratories having anywhere between 4 and 100 bioreactors. The SmartLab platform incorporates modern tools such as Microsoft.NET and the OSIsoft PI System' historian."

"By combining RECONN with Finesse's industry-leading bioreactor control software and SmartSystems into our SmartLab platform, Finesse continues to lead in providing state-of-the-art tools for bioprocess research and development," said Dr. Barbara Paldus, CEO and co-founder of Finesse. "The flexibility of harmonizing analyzers and bioreactor controllers from a wide variety of suppliers with statistical analysis tools and electronic batch reporting will enable our customers to gain efficiency in their development of new biologics. We are excited to extend the capabilities of our SMART platforms with a new data management tool that enables easy DoE configuration, a modern user interface and instant access to batch information. This is the first step in Finesse's goal of accelerating the adoption of both Automation 4.0 and the Internet of Things (IoT) in bioprocessing, which are both long overdue."

About Finesse Solutions, Inc.

California-based Finesse Solutions, Inc. has a proven record in providing turnkey, scalable solutions for single-use upstream bioprocessing and has begun innovating in solutions for downstream bioprocessing as well. The Finesse product platform includes state-of-the-art disposable sensors, modular automation hardware and intelligent software that can harmonize data and technology transfer globally. Finesse also offers a complete set of services, including commissioning and validation for rapid and reliable deployment of single-use equipment. For more information, please visit www.finesse.com.

About One Hill Solutions, Inc.

One Hill Solutions, Inc. is a software development company located in Hopedale, Massachusetts. One Hill Solutions focuses on all aspects of data management visualization and analysis along with OSI-PI integration, start-up support and commissioning.
